croatiaCROATIA: Neolithic Europeans coveted hunting trophies just like modern hunters. In the remains of a prehistoric home, alongside traces of wood furniture, researchers found a massive set of antlers—arm-length, with 14 points—that may have been hung on the wall as a trophy. They estimate the red deer buck would have weighed close to 500 pounds—a major prize for hunters armed only with stone weapons 6,500 years ago. —Samir S. Patel
